About Ruopeng Wang
Ruopeng Wang is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Biomedical Engineering and Cognitive Neuroscience, having authored 62 papers that have together received 4.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Neuroimaging Techniques and Applications (25 papers), Advanced MRI Techniques and Applications (13 papers), Fetal and Pediatric Neurological Disorders (10 papers), Advanced Memory and Neural Computing (10 papers), Functional Brain Connectivity Studies (6 papers), Perovskite Materials and Applications (4 papers), Ferroelectric and Negative Capacitance Devices (4 papers) and Dysphagia Assessment and Management (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(2.0k citations), Computational Mathematics (44 citations), Cognitive Neuroscience (1.1k citations),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health (532 citations) and Neurology (214 citations). Ruopeng Wang has collaborated with scholars based in United States, China and Germany. Frequent co-authors include A. Gregory Sorensen, Van J. Wedeen, Sean C. McInerney, Verne S. Caviness, Nikos Makris, David N. Kennedy, Deepak Ν. Pandya, Thomas Benner, Ye Zhou and Su‐Ting Han. Their work appears in journals such as NeuroImage, Neurosurgery, Solid State Communications, IEEE Transactions on Plasma Science and Journal of Magnetic Resonance Imaging.
